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Linxe to Toulouse is to drive which costs €35 - €55 and takes 3h 27m.
The fastest way to get from Linxe to Toulouse is to drive which takes 3h 27m and costs €35 - €55.
The distance between Linxe and Toulouse is 331 km. The road distance is 246.1 km.
The best way to get from Linxe to Toulouse without a car is to train which takes 4h 56m and costs €100 - €150.
It takes approximately 4h 56m to get from Linxe to Toulouse, including transfers.
The best way to get from Linxe to Toulouse is to train which takes 4h 56m and costs €100 - €150. Alternatively, you can bus via Bordeaux, which costs €30 - €70 and takes 5h 32m.
Yes, the driving distance between Linxe to Toulouse is 246 km. It takes approximately 3h 27m to drive from Linxe to Toulouse.
